The RYA welcomes the further easing of restrictions for sports facilities in England which will take effect on 25th July. This will make it possible for your club to open its changing facilities, provided it meets the requirements set out by the Department for Digital, Culture, Media and Sport; these are included in our Club Guidance on restarting boating.
Over the past week we have shared our club guidance with the Department for Digital, Culture, Media and Sport in order to gain a better understanding of the exact implications of the return to sports framework for our sport. In particular clarity around the crewing of boats by people from multiple households and the limitations for regatta organisers.
